Health and safety promotion (2018/2019)
The teaching is organized as follows:
Learning outcomes
The course introduces the student to the understanding of the determinants of health. It aims to know how to deal with risk factors applying prevention strategies both at the individual and collective level. It also aims to understand the causes, the pathogenic mechanisms, and methods of prevention and control of infectious diseases.

MM: MICROBIOLOGIA CLINICA
------------------------
Purposes of Microbiology. Classification of microorganisms in the world of the living. General Bacteriology: morphology, structure and function of the cell bacterial. Notes on playback. Mode of transmission of infectious diseases. Mechanisms of pathogenic bacteria; Conventional pathogens and opportunists. endotoxin protein and toxins. Antimicrobial agents: classification and mechanisms of action of the main antibacterial and main mechanisms of resistance (susceptibility) Special Bacteriology: Staphylococci, Streptococci and Enterococci; Neisseria; Emofili; mycobacteria; Enterobacteriaceae, Pseudomonas. General Virology: virus definition, composition and architecture of the d viral particle. Outline of direplicazione mechanisms. Mechanisms of pathogenic viruses: localized infection, generalized, silent, persistent and latent. Overview of antiviral agents. Special Virology: Herpesviridae, hepatitis virus (HAV, HBV, HCV, HDV), Orthomixoviridae, Papillomaviridae, Retroviridae (HIV). fundamental characteristics of human pathogenic fungi and parasites. Approach to microbiological diagnosis of bacterial and viral infections: direct and indirect diagnosis. Taking and storing samples (blood culture apparatus samples respiratory, urinary samples from the apparatus). Outline of nosocomial infections and bacterial endocarditis.

MM: METODOLOGIA EPIDEMIOLOGICA, IGIENE E PROBLEMI PRIORITARI DI SALUTE
------------------------
1. Introduction to Epidemiology: definition, objectives and epidemiology characteristics, measures in epidemiology 2. The concept of health, disease and causes of disease epidemiology. Criteria for assessing the causal link 3. Epidemiological studies: descriptive, analytical, experimental 4. Elements for the assessment of the main problems of health of a population: major diseases in the general population, leading causes of death in the general population 5. Epidemiology and prevention of infectious diseases: epidemiological chain and and transmission mode: (endemic, sporadic, epidemic diseases), the direct and indirect prophylaxis of infectious diseases, the specific prophylaxis (vaccine prophylaxis, basic knowledge of serum prophylaxis and chemoprophylaxis) 6. Epidemiology and primary and secondary prevention of major chronic diseases: ischemic heart disease, diabetes, COPD, malignancies 7. screening tests

Examination Methods
Written exam with multiple choice questions in proportion to the teaching hours of the individual modules. For the nursing module there are also open questions with minimal arguments.
The exam must be passed in all four modules. An oral integration is foreseen in case one of the modules results with a slight inadequacy. The final vote is expressed in thirtieths.
